Does Lorenzo's Oil acts at the endoplasmic reticulum or the peroxisome?

Lorenzo's Oil works by targeting the peroxisome in cells. It helps reduce the build-up of very long-chain fatty acids, which is a hallmark of certain peroxisomal disorders like adrenoleukodystrophy. By promoting the breakdown of these fatty acids, Lorenzo's Oil aims to alleviate symptoms and slow disease progression.


Do peroxisomes self replicate?

Yes, peroxisomes can replicate themselves through a process called fission, where a new peroxisome buds off from an existing one. This helps in maintaining peroxisome numbers and functions within the cell.
